To disable the Vortex under screen cleaner carry out the following:
1. Press the function key F10 on the keyboard, a window of the following form
is displayed:
2. Type vortoff using the keyboard.
3. Press Enter, the message ‘Vortex Under-Screen Cleaner Disabled’ is
displayed in the message prompt bar.
The silver under screen cleaner becomes the current cleaner and all cleaner
parameters revert to being appropriate to the previous cleaner.
The value of the configuration parameter cleaner type is set to silver and this
parameter is written to the configuration file.
4. Press Exit.

Paste Trails Provides the capability to reduce solder paste trails from squeegees
automatically, options are:
Disabled; Mode 1
If mode 1 is selected, any paste that has dripped from the squeegee is scooped up,
by the squeegee back to the paste roll. This process occurs at the start of every
stroke, with the print mode set to print/print and at the start of only the print
stroke, when the print mode is set to flood/print or print/flood.
Transport Wait
Mode
This option enables the product to be held in contact with the screen until both
upline and downline systems are ready to transfer, options are:
Standard; Hold_at_Print
The default is Standard.
Clamp Type Sets the type of board clamp used, options are:
Board Clamp; Snuggers
The default is Board Clamps.
To eliminate vacuum seal loss during alignment, if the Snuggers option is
selected and the tooling type is Vacuum, the rails do not dip when the camera is
traversing.
Snugger Thickness This parameter is only available if Snuggers has been selected from the Clamp
Type preference, options are:
Min 0.8mm
Max 2.0mm (2.01mm is displayed but 2.0mm is the maximum value selectable)
Increments 0.1mm
The default is 1.6mm.
Tooling Monitoring This parameter sets, while Feature Licensing asserts that use of Tooling
Deviation Monitoring is authorized, the frequency (in boards printed) at which
monitoring is performed. Monitoring is also carried out on the first print stroke
of a print run.
Min 0 boards (Tooling Monitoring disabled)
Max 200 boards
Increments 1
The default is 0 boards.
This feature only applies while squeegees are fitted.

When a particular print stroke is being monitored, as the squeegee traverses the
image the pressure being applied is measured and recorded. Any variations in
the load being applied, as a result of insufficient tooling support or underside
components coming into contact with the tooling are noted. Upon completion of
the print stroke, the deviation in the pressure applied over the print stroke is
determined and expressed as the tooling deviation. The tooling deviation is
calculated from the minimum and maximum values and expressed as a
percentage. If the tooling deviation exceeds the permitted threshold, as set by
the Tooling Deviation parameter in the product file, a cyclic log text file called
deviate.dat is written and the following window is displayed:
NOTE
The number of samples is the amount of pressure variations recorded during the
print stroke.

If the number of samples (pressure variations) during a print stroke is less than 2
or the minimum value is zero, the error message ‘Failed to determine Tooling
Deviation’ is displayed.
